Lawrence Chen eb7c06ceb1 Fix high CPU usage from notifications and add regression tests
- Fix auto-updating Text(date, style: .time) causing continuous SwiftUI updates
  by using static formatting with .formatted(date:time:)
- Fix notification popover keeping SwiftUI observers active when closed by
  clearing contentViewController on popover close and recreating on open
- Fix focus loss when notifications arrive while typing by only setting
  focus in NotificationsPage when the page is visible
- Make Update Pill and Update Logs debug-only features
- Add CPU regression tests: test_cpu_usage.py, test_cpu_notifications.py
- Add lint test for auto-updating Text patterns: test_lint_swiftui_patterns.py

import Foundation
import AppKit
final class UpdateLogStore {
static let shared = UpdateLogStore()
private let queue = DispatchQueue(label: "cmuxterm.update.log")
private var entries: [String] = []
private let maxEntries = 200
private let logURL: URL
private let formatter: ISO8601DateFormatter
private init() {
formatter = ISO8601DateFormatter()
formatter.formatOptions = [.withInternetDateTime, .withFractionalSeconds]
let logsDir = FileManager.default.urls(for: .libraryDirectory, in: .userDomainMask).first
?? FileManager.default.temporaryDirectory
logURL = logsDir.appendingPathComponent("Logs/cmuxterm-update.log")
ensureLogFile()
}
func append(_ message: String) {
#if DEBUG
let timestamp = formatter.string(from: Date())
let line = "[\(timestamp)] \(message)"
queue.async { [weak self] in
guard let self else { return }
entries.append(line)
if entries.count > maxEntries {
entries.removeFirst(entries.count - maxEntries)
}
appendToFile(line: line)
}
#endif
}
func snapshot() -> String {
queue.sync {
entries.joined(separator: "\n")
}
}
func logPath() -> String {
logURL.path
}
private func ensureLogFile() {
let directory = logURL.deletingLastPathComponent()
try? FileManager.default.createDirectory(at: directory, withIntermediateDirectories: true)
if !FileManager.default.fileExists(atPath: logURL.path) {
try? Data().write(to: logURL)
}
}
private func appendToFile(line: String) {
let data = Data((line + "\n").utf8)
if let handle = try? FileHandle(forWritingTo: logURL) {
try? handle.seekToEnd()
try? handle.write(contentsOf: data)
try? handle.close()
} else {
try? data.write(to: logURL, options: .atomic)
}
}
}
